First, let’s break down what a reverse circulation (RC) drill pipe actually is. Unlike traditional drilling methods where the drilling fluid is pumped down the drill pipe and returns up the annulus, reverse circulation works by pulling the fluid back up through the drill pipe. This unique design enables faster and cleaner sampling, making it an ideal choice for various drilling applications.
Faster Drilling Speeds
Time is money, especially in industries like mining and oil. According to a study by the International Association of Drilling Contractors, projects using reverse circulation drilling techniques can often complete tasks 30% faster than those employing traditional methods. This speed comes from the efficiency of returning chips quickly to the surface, minimizing downtime and boosting productivity.
Enhanced Sample Quality
Have you ever questioned the integrity of your drill samples? With RC drilling, the samples retrieved are more representative of the geological conditions. The reverse circulation process reduces contamination because of the downward flow, yielding clearer, higher-quality samples. This can be crucial for decision-making when analyzing mineral content or groundwater quality.
